York County Sheriff’s Office taking part in joint investigation with FBI in Waterboro

The York County Sheriff’s Office notified the public about an investigation involving the FBI in Waterboro on Wednesday.

The sheriff’s office said it was conducting “investigative activity” at the 700 block of Main Street and that there was no threat to public safety.

Residents and businesses in the area were told to expect increased police presence but to continue normal daily activities.

More details about the investigation are expected, but the sheriff’s office said there are no plans to release details this week.
